Air Force Athletes Chase Olympic Dreams

Air Force athletes are training for the Olympics through the World Class Athlete Program (WCAP), which allows them to train full-time while on active duty. Airman First Class Anita Alvarez, 2nd Lt. Texas Tanner, and 1st Lt. Wyatt Hendrickson are among those training for the 2028 Los Angeles Olympics.

WCAP Program

The WCAP program’s mission has taken on added weight since the U.S. Central Command launched Operation Epic Fury against Iran. The program allows elite athletes to compete at the highest level, promote the service, and attempt to qualify for the Olympic Games.

Alvarez, a established Olympic medalist, entered the Air Force as part of the WCAP program. She has won two World Cup bronze medals and a team acrobatic gold medal since joining the service. Tanner, a Sheridan, Wyoming native, completed one of the strongest throwing careers in Air Force Academy history and won his first senior national championship in the discus.

Hendrickson, a graduate of the Air Force Academy, used his final season of college eligibility at Oklahoma State while serving on active duty through the WCAP program. He won the NCAA heavyweight wrestling championship and finished the season undefeated.

Transition to Military Operations

Retired Air Force combat rescue officer Chad Senior is an example of how an elite athlete’s experience can translate into operational military service. Senior competed in modern pentathlon through the Army’s World Class Athlete Program and later became an Air Force combat rescue officer, serving with the 920th Rescue Wing and 308th Rescue Squadron.
